Do you make white and kraft edge protectors?
Last Updated: 10/13/2015


White is our default edge protector. White edge protectors are the most common, most economical and and are white on top.

A one-color flexographic print may also be added to communicate product information or handling instructions:



Kraft edge protectors are structurally the same as white edge protectors, but without the top white paper. There's no difference in price between kraft and white edge protectors. One-color flexographic printing is also available on kraft:
